Last month I started bringing my laptop to work with me, I also have wireless at home. Now every few days it decides it will show I am connected to my network but I can not connect to the internet. When I try to repair it says Arp cache can not clear. I have cleared it in command prompt it will say ok and then let me run the repair connection seccessfully but still won't let me connect.
I can temporarily get around this by system restoring to the previous day but of course that doesn't really solve my problem and after 3 or 4 days of going between wireless networks I end up with the same problem.
I have ran a network diagnostics it came back failed DNServerSearchOrder.
What else can I try doing?
